Brisbane are flash and they make no apologies about it and for that, even as champions, some people will never forgive them.

But as the blood dries and the wounds heal following Brisbane's 26-22 grand final win over Melbourne, let it never again be said they're anything less than the true steel.

This is a team of incredible attacking verve and athleticism and that was on show, as ever, but what has marked their ascension to the NRL's throne is a resilience that would defy belief if we hadn't seen it with our own eyes.
